I have 2 My Cloud devices at home and 3 others that I connect to remotely. I’ve been using all or some of these drives for years and though I’ve had to tweak some settings here and there as software has evolved, everything has been working smoothly and my speeds have been “relatively” good and consistent when transferring between devices, even remotely.
I just updated the desktop software app on 2 computers, one running windows 8 and the other, windows 7.
Since updating the desktop software I noticed 2 things:
1- it no longer displays the upload time remaining when transferring files to the remote drive.
2- my remote transfer speeds are about 5 times slower than they were yesterday before the update.
Is there a problem with WD servers today? A bug in the new software? Will the “time remaining” status be fixed?
